HL Deb 25 February 2002 vol 631 c171WA
Lord Moynihan

asked Her Majesty's Government:

Further to the answer by the Lord Grocott on 30 January (HL Deb, col. 214), whether the High Commissioner, Mr David Merry, has visited the bushmen of the Central Kalahari in the Central Kalahari Game Reserve and on what date; and, if he has not, whether they will explain Lord Grocott's statement on 30 January. [HL2760]

Baroness Amos

Our High Commissioner has not visited the Central Kalahari Game Reserve itself. As Lord Grocott made clear in his answer on 30 January, our High Commissioner did visit the area surrounding the reserve from 9–12 December 2001. The specific area which he visited was the Ghanzi district, which lies just outside the reserve. The High Commissioner visited three areas where the Bushmen have been resettled. The visit was part of the High Commissioner's familiarisation programme in Botswana. A visit to the reserve itself will take place as soon as it can be arranged.
